Date: Mon, 16 Jan 2006 12:27:09 -0500 (EST) From: Charles Swiger <chuck@pkix.net> To: FreeBSD-gnats-submit@FreeBSD.org Subject: ports/91874: update port: sysutils/dvd+rw-tools to v6.0 (may need testing!) Message-ID: <20060116172709.BE99354B3@pkix-gw.codefab.com> Resent-Message-ID: <200601161730.k0GHU47I014861@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 91874 >Category: ports >Synopsis: update port: sysutils/dvd+rw-tools to v6.0 (may need testing!) >Confidential: no >Severity: non-critical >Priority: medium >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: maintainer-update >Submitter-Id: current-users >Arrival-Date: Mon Jan 16 17:30:03 GMT 2006 >Closed-Date: >Last-Modified: >Originator: Charles Swiger >Release: FreeBSD 4.11-STABLE i386 >Organization: PKIx >Environment: System: FreeBSD ns1.pkix.net 4.11-STABLE FreeBSD 4.11-STABLE #0: Sat Jun 18 18:51:43 EDT 2005 root@ns1.pkix.net:/usr/obj/usr/src/sys/NORMAL i386 >Description: Update dvd+rw-tools port to v6.0. This new version may need testing by more people since it now wants ~40MB of wired-down memory via calling mlockall(). Patch for making it go without mlock()ing on FreeBSD-4 included. :-) Caveat: >How-To-Repeat: N/A. >Fix: diff -durP dvd+rw-tools-old/Makefile dvd+rw-tools/Makefile --- dvd+rw-tools-old/Makefile Mon Jan 16 11:39:42 2006 +++ dvd+rw-tools/Makefile Mon Jan 16 11:40:18 2006 @@ -5,7 +5,7 @@ # $FreeBSD: ports/sysutils/dvd+rw-tools/Makefile,v 1.17 2004/12/15 22:56:46 ahze Exp $ PORTNAME= dvd+rw-tools -PORTVERSION= 5.21.4.10.8 +PORTVERSION= 6.0 CATEGORIES= sysutils MASTER_SITES= http://www.pkix.net/mirror/fy.chalmers.se/ \ http://fy.chalmers.se/~appro/linux/DVD+RW/tools/ diff -durP dvd+rw-tools-old/distinfo dvd+rw-tools/distinfo --- dvd+rw-tools-old/distinfo Mon Jan 16 11:39:42 2006 +++ dvd+rw-tools/distinfo Mon Jan 16 12:10:01 2006 @@ -1,3 +1,3 @@ -MD5 (dvd+rw-tools-5.21.4.10.8.tar.gz) = b931c02e2b23342f664276ef26d1502c -SHA256 (dvd+rw-tools-5.21.4.10.8.tar.gz) = 6d233df4429583c5a36df3328cd74e71e39aed6bb90586998fe6a8dcd3ba514b -SIZE (dvd+rw-tools-5.21.4.10.8.tar.gz) = 107045 +MD5 (dvd+rw-tools-6.0.tar.gz) = 0c2b8afa027b93b84005ccd1c06fbd54 +SHA256 (dvd+rw-tools-6.0.tar.gz) = 17cdb64c5daa0ee553984a397434a8ed63a25fae5807b39613fec8df382e4729 +SIZE (dvd+rw-tools-6.0.tar.gz) = 118804 diff -durP dvd+rw-tools-old/files/patch-growisofs.c dvd+rw-tools/files/patch-growisofs.c --- dvd+rw-tools-old/files/patch-growisofs.c Wed Dec 31 19:00:00 1969 +++ dvd+rw-tools/files/patch-growisofs.c Mon Jan 16 12:10:18 2006 @@ -0,0 +1,12 @@ +--- growisofs.c_old Mon Jan 16 06:09:41 2006 ++++ growisofs.c Mon Jan 16 12:02:04 2006 +@@ -2194,7 +2194,9 @@ + nice(-20); + /* I'd rather do it right after I allocate ring buffer and fire off + * threads, but I'll be running without extra privileges by then:-( */ ++#if !defined(__FreeBSD__) || __FreeBSD__ >= 5 + mlockall(MCL_CURRENT|MCL_FUTURE); ++#endif + #endif + + mkisofs_argv = malloc ((argc+3)*sizeof(char *)); >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20060116172709.BE99354B3>